Description
This rare swinging railroad bridge was located at Elkmont. Left to right are: Caroline Shelton (seated) Leona Shelton and Effie Shelton (standing), John and Hazel Shelton, standing on the railroad track. Otis and Nora Shelton (half brother and sister to Jim Shelton) at extreme right.
